How did Frances Harper Help the slaves escape along the underground railroad?

Frances Harper, a prominent African American abolitionist and poet, contributed to the Underground Railroad by using her writing and speaking engagements to raise awareness about the plight of enslaved people. She assisted in the escape efforts by helping to provide resources, support, and guidance to those seeking freedom. Harper also collaborated with other abolitionists and participated in various organizations dedicated to aiding fugitive slaves, thereby playing a crucial role in the broader movement against slavery.


Who is Frances Harper?

= Frances Harper is a famous author =Her mother died when she was three years old in 1828 and after that, Harper was looked after by her aunt and uncle. She was educated at a school run by her uncle, Rev. William Watkins, until the age of fourteen when she found work as a seamstress. Her first volume of verse, Forest Leaves, was published in 1845, the book was extremely popular and over the next few years went through 20 editions. In 1850, she started working in Columbus, Ohio as a schoolteacher. Three years later in 1853, she joined the American Anti-Slavery Society and became a traveling lecturer for the group. She married Fenton Harper in 1860. She was also a strong supporter of prohibition and woman's suffrage as well as a member of the Unitarian Church. She often would read her poetry at these public meetings, including the extremely popular Bury Me in a Free Land.Frances Harper died on 22 February 1911.
